Grapefuit (グレープフルーツ Gureipufuruto?) is the debut studio album of Japanese singer Maaya Sakamoto.[1] Production and all music composition was by Yoko Kanno, but she wrote the lyrics for the songs "Migi Hoppe no Nikibi" and "Orange Iro to Yubikiri", and co-wrote a third, "Feel Myself", with Yūho Iwasato.
